Full Name: Marcel Sabitzer
Date of Birth: Mar 17, 1994 (28)
Nationality: Austria

Height: 177cm
Position: Midfield - Central Midfield
Foot: Right
Player Agent: Rogon
Squad Number: #15
Joined: 31 Jan, 2023
Contract Expires: Jun 30, 2023
On Loan From: Bayern Munich

Contract There Expires: Jun 30, 2025​
